TAMPA - The Tampa Bay Buccaneers head coach, some players, and team mascot all helped hand over a new car to a very deserving Hillsborough Community College student today.
Kiara Walker, 21, won the 2010 Ford Focus through the team’s “Road to Success” program. She was selected out of 180 applicants that were nominated by friends and family on the Buccaneers website.
The team asked fans to share their stories about Bay Area residents who they thought were deserving of a new car.
Walker has been working since she was 15-years-old, she now also takes car of her five month old daughter, and goes to school several times each week.
In addition to all her daily life requires of her, Walker is in the process of starting a non-profit organization dedicated to inspiring girls and young women to achieve their goals.
Walker’s story is the reason why the Bucs decided to give her the new car. The team was hoping to surprise her in class today. However, she was taking a test today, finished early and wanted to get to her next class. Her teacher knew about the surprise and tried to get her to stay. However, walker ended up leaving.
She walked outside the room and ran into the team as they were setting up on the street. So, she actually surprised the Bucs when she walked down the stairs.
Nevertheless, Walker was extremely excited about the new car and all that it will help her accomplish.
